description Product Description

Primarily used in organic synthesis, this compound serves as a building block for the preparation of various pharmaceutical intermediates. It is particularly valuable in the development of active pharmaceutical ingredients (APIs) due to its amine functionality, which can be easily modified or incorporated into larger molecules. Additionally, it finds application in the production of specialty chemicals, where its structure contributes to the creation of surfactants or corrosion inhibitors. Its hydrochloride form enhances solubility, making it suitable for use in aqueous reaction systems. In research, it is employed as a reagent for studying reaction mechanisms or developing new synthetic pathways.
